Programs that open and convert CR3 files:
- Digital Photo Professional by Canon
See the previous paragraphs to learn more about the main application. CR3 files are often referred to as Digital Photo Professional camera raws because this type of file is primarily created or used by this software.
- Lightroom (raw image) by AdobeLightroom is an image manipulation and image organization software distributed as part of Creative Cloud. It features tools for editing, organizing, and transferring images across mobile and desktop devices. Lightroom can import, display, and edit images saved in Canon RAW 3 (CR3) format. This file format is classified as Camera Raw. Related links: Raw image format
- PhotoLab (raw image) by DXOPhotoLab is a photo-editing software for Windows and Mac operating system. You can open and edit CR3 images using PhotoLab. This file format is classified as Camera Raw. Related links: Raw image format
CR3 file format:
If you can determine the file format, the associated program can also be determined. The initial characters of a file are called signature, sometimes also referred to as "magic bytes". The signature can be used to infer the file format. If the file extension does not match the file format, double-clicking on the file will cause an error upon opening. Knowledge is power - this also applies when dealing with unknown or faulty files. Below you will find our evaluation of the CR3 files:
The CR3 file extension is very common and predominantly uses a uniform format. The two most popular formats are as follows:
- 97% of all CR3 files are Canon Digital Camera RAW image files, which are based on the MP4 file format. MP4 is a multimedia container format used to store video and audio and allows streaming over the Internet. If you open these files in a text editor, you will see only illegible characters. The files are often between 17 MB and 38 MB in size. This file type is based on cutting-edge technology. Certain words are almost always found in the files, such as CCDT, F+jH, crx isom, ftypcrx, \CCTP, &CNCVCanonCR3_001/00.09.00/00.00.00, uuid, moov, pCTBO and \CTBO. These files are attributed to eosr, imgl and tula.
- 1% of all CR3 files are associated with CoolReader 3 cache. The contents of these files cannot be read by a human; only a computer program can interpret the data. The file size is in the range of 450 KB to 4 MB. The keywords Cache File and CoolReader 3 Cache File v3 are typical for these files.
